Output 5ecb8ba91c67b23a1cf5e834db0fd4e5bbb0a4d58a78ee31eea1fb873637c9d5:12

value
19605
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1eeecf4c1312f5f159be04fcd6a91b94250f1ac3 OP_EQUALVERIFY OP_CHECKSIG
address
13pZMYkxdHrRLj9KNCNVRupScU4e5HyHpb
transaction
5ecb8ba91c67b23a1cf5e834db0fd4e5bbb0a4d58a78ee31eea1fb873637c9d5
confirmations
49285
spent
true